Period / Bleeding at 8 weeks pregnant

5 replies

hannahq2 · 16/08/2021 15:20

I am 8 weeks and 5 days pregnant. I have already had 2 scans as I'm such a worrier! I had one 2 days ago and heard the baby's little healthy heartbeat.

Earlier on in the pregnancy, I had the implantation bleeding which was just a light coloured spotting on my tissue. This morning, I have woken up to a heavy bleeding and cramps, which to me feels exactly like a period! I've felt quite period like for a few days.

I have been to the hospital to get checked, they checked my blood and said that it's okay, but they haven't explained what could be happening or why it's happening. I'm really worrying because it feels as though I'm having a period but apparently that doesn't happen in pregnancy.

Has anyone experienced anything similar / can offer any reassurance? like I said I'm a bit of a worrier!

Thank you :)

Alltimeblow · 16/08/2021 15:53

Did they scan you at the hospital? Was it A&E? You need to contact your local EPU if you haven't already, they should absolutely want to get you in for a scan. It could go either way OP but any time I've had cramps accompanied by bleeding, I've miscarried. I hope this is not the case for you of course but you do really need a scan and in my experience, EPU will scan you asap for the issues you are having. I hope it turns out okay Flowers

Just to update you, I had my scan today I have a little baby in my belly and I'm exactly 9 weeks. There's nothing to be worried about as everything looks how it should. We believe it's a little bleed I'm probably going to get every month around the time of my period as this is very common but there's no explanation for it. But yes, baby is completely fine and is looking like an actual little baby now. Thank you for your response x
